Soundmatters has announced the new foxLv2 Platinum Bluetooth speaker, a pocket-sized Hi-Fi speaker for audio purists. The latest in the company’s award-winning foxL series, the foxLv2 adds a trio of new performance features including advancements in Bluetooth streaming technology for CD quality music, new audiophile cabling and extended battery life. Sporting a new “platinum” finish, the foxLv2 includes support for the Blutooth CSR apt-X streaming protocols for wireless connectivity to Bluetooth equipped devices such as the iPhone, iPod touch, iPad or Mac or users can connecting to an audio source using the included 3.5mm Audioquest Evergreen cable; Bluetooth speakerphone capability is also included with a built-in noise cancelling microphone.

The foxLv2 speakers can be used either with an AC connection for increased wattage output or on the internal rechargeable Lithium-Ion battery for up to 10 hours of battery life using Bluetooth or 20 hours with a wired audio connection. The foxLv2 Platinum is priced at $229 and is expected to be available from Soundmatters and other retailers beginning in November.
